Summary: ROWS_SCANNED scan metric double-counts rows passing the
filter when the scan uses the joined heap (essential column family filtering)

When a scan enables {{Scan#setLoadColumnFamiliesOnDemand(true)}} and its filter
marks some column families as non-essential ({{{}Filter#isFamilyEssential{}}},
introduced by HBASE-5416), {{RegionScannerImpl}} populates a row in two steps:
the essential families through the store heap and — only if the row passes the
filter — the remaining families through the joined heap.
Both steps go through {{{}RegionScannerImpl#populateResult{}}}, which
increments the ROWS_SCANNED metric
({{{}ServerSideScanMetrics.COUNT_OF_ROWS_SCANNED_KEY_METRIC_NAME{}}},
introduced by HBASE-5980) each time the given heap finishes the current row:
{code:java}
nextKv = heap.peek();
moreCellsInRow = moreCellsInRow(nextKv, currentRowCell);
if (!moreCellsInRow) {
incrementCountOfRowsScannedMetric(scannerContext);
} {code}
There is no guard against the second call on the joined heap, so every row that
passes the filter and has data in a non-essential family is counted twice —
once when the store heap finishes the row and once more when the joined heap
finishes it. Rows rejected by the filter are counted once. The reported value
effectively becomes "rows scanned + rows returned", which breaks the metric for
its usual purposes (filter selectivity / scan efficiency analysis, the
MapReduce {{ROWS_SCANNED}} HBase counter, comparisons against
{{{}ROWS_FILTERED{}}}).
Reproduction with stock filters only:
# Create a table with two column families, e.g. {{essential}} and
{{{}joined{}}}, and put a cell in both families for every row.
# Scan with {{{}setScanMetricsEnabled(true){}}},
{{setLoadColumnFamiliesOnDemand(true)}} and a {{SingleColumnValueFilter}} on
family {{essential}} with {{setFilterIfMissing(true)}} (this makes the other
family non-essential via {{{}SingleColumnValueFilter#isFamilyEssential{}}}).
# With 10 rows of which 5 match the filter, ROWS_SCANNED reports 15 instead of
10, while ROWS_FILTERED correctly reports 5. Without
{{setLoadColumnFamiliesOnDemand(true)}} the same scan reports 10.
The double counting is invisible in the existing
{{TestServerSideScanMetricsFromClientSide}} because its table has a single
column family, so the joined heap is never exercised.
Proposed fix: count a completed row in {{populateResult}} only when populating
from the store heap. The joined heap only re-populates rows that already passed
the filter, so the store heap completion is the single canonical "row scanned"
event (rows filtered by row key keep their separate increment in
{{{}nextInternal{}}}). A PR with the fix and a unit test in
{{TestServerSideScanMetricsFromClientSide}} follows.
Verified on branch-2, branch-2.6, branch-3 and master (same code in
{{populateResult}} / {{{}populateFromJoinedHeap{}}}).
